Jacqui Pember

Co-Founder and Education Lead

Jacqui Pember

Jacqui helped establish Janet's Junction during the COVID-19 crisis, starting with a grassroots sandwich distribution initiative for families in need. She is deeply passionate about improving educational access and outcomes for children in Phoenix and Joe Slovo, believing that education is the most powerful tool to change future opportunities. Today, she drives the organisation's education-focused programmes and strategic direction.

Jason Stanfield

Director and Soup Kitchen Lead

Jason Stanfield

Jason is the son of the late Janet Stanfield, after whom the organisation is named. He stepped into leadership following Janet's passing in 2022 and now plays a central role in running the organisation's food relief programme. Twice a week, Jason cooks and distributes nutritious meals for local children, unhoused individuals and families with no income. His work honours his mother's legacy and keeps the heart of Janet's Junction beating. He is supported by his wife, Stacy.

Ursula Barends

Co-Founder

Ursula Barends

Ursula, then the Ward 4 PR councillor, played a key role in the early days of the project. A close friend of Janet, she introduced her into the initiative and worked alongside her to deliver food directly into the community. Ursula, Janet and another volunteer personally pushed trolley loads of sandwiches through Joe Slovo every week, ensuring food reached the people who needed it most.

Janine McEvoy

Co-Founder

Janine McEvoy

Janine founded the Milnerton CAN during the 2020 lockdown and was instrumental in sparking the idea of distributing sandwiches to vulnerable families. Together with Jacqui and Ursula, she helped establish an organised, community-driven system for collecting and distributing food. Her early leadership and mobilisation of volunteers helped lay the foundation for what later became Janet's Junction.

Stacy Stanfield

Operations and Kitchen Support

Stacy Stanfield

Stacy Stanfield is a vital part of Janet's Junction's day-to-day work. As Jason's wife and closest support, she is essential to the soup kitchen operations. Stacy assists with food distribution, ensures supplies are available and helps keep the kitchen running smoothly. Her hands-on involvement, practical support and quiet dedication make it possible for meals to reach those who need them most.

Yolande Verhoef

Finance and Administration

Yolande Verhoef

Yolande Verhoef is a qualified accountant who supports Janet's Junction with all financial compliance and statutory obligations. She manages liaison with SARS, CIPC and other relevant bodies, ensuring the organisation operates responsibly, transparently and in full compliance with regulatory requirements.
